Code center > Bug reports

Getting stucked bug

<< < (2/2)

Numsgil:
Force one to reproduce by opening the console of one and typing "set .repro 50" (or it might be other syntax combination, I can never remember).

There might also be a button on the robot details that says "Reproduce" or "reproduction" or something like that.  Try clicking that and making the bot reproduce.

If the bot was unstuck before and after this forced reproduction becomes fixed, or its child becomes fixed, we might indeed have an odd error.

Testlund:
They don't get stuck when I click reproduce, only when they reproduce themselves. Here is a bot that is stuck and has reproduced. Do you see anything in the DNA that could cause it to get stuck?

 start
 angle rnd and
 pyth inc
 mod stop
 start
 angle rnd and
 pyth inc
 mod stop
 start
 angle rnd xor
 pyth inc
 mod stop
 start
 angle rnd and
 pyth inc
 mod stop
 start
 angle rnd and
 pyth inc
 mod stop
 start
 angle rnd and
 pyth inc
 mod stop
 start
 angle rnd and
 pyth inc
 mod stop
 start
 angle rnd and
 pyth inc
 mod stop
 start
 angle rnd and
 pyth inc
 mod stop
 start
 angle rnd and
 pyth inc
 mod stop
 start
 angle rnd and
 pyth inc
 mod stop
 start
 angle rnd and
 pyth inc
 mod stop
 start
 angle rnd and
 pyth inc
 mod stop
 start
 angle rnd and
 pyth inc
 mod stop
 0 0 0 2 0 0 0 1 0 0 0 sqr 0 0 -9

EricL:
What is the waste threshold and what is this bot's waste?  Altzheimer's fixing the bot is a prime suspect....

Numsgil:
It's that virally related gene I posted about in the other thread.
 
--- Code: ---  start
  angle rnd xor
  pyth inc
  mod stop
--- End code ---

 This gene will randomly increment all sorts of random sysvars.  One of those sysvars is probably .fixpos

This is really quite exciting!  That gene has the potential of being the first reproductively effective "wild" gene ever seen!

Testlund:
Yeah, it's from the same sim that I've posted about in the 'Simplest evo starting bot' topic. But all my saves have gotten corrupted.  

Navigation

[0] Message Index

[*] Previous page

Go to full version